Course Overview

The Gynecology & Obstetrics Ultrasound Simulation Training Program is designed to develop safe, structured, and reproducible ultrasound scanning skills for women’s health imaging. The course focuses on pelvic and early obstetric ultrasound techniques using a high-fidelity simulation platform that allows learners to practice probe handling, orientation, and image optimization without patient dependency.

Participants train in both transabdominal and transvaginal ultrasound approaches, learning to translate probe movements into accurate anatomical visualization. Emphasis is placed on understanding pelvic anatomy, first-trimester obstetric assessment, and systematic scanning workflows rather than isolated image capture.

Through repeated simulation and guided instruction, learners build scanning confidence, anatomical clarity, and diagnostic consistency- preparing them for supervised clinical practice while minimizing early-stage scanning errors.

Course Modules
Module 1: Fundamentals of OBGYN Ultrasound
  • Ultrasound basics for gynecology and obstetrics
  • Machine controls and knobology
  • Patient positioning and scan preparation
Module 2: Female Pelvis Ultrasound – Transabdominal Approach
  • Uterus, ovaries, and urinary bladder imaging
  • Abdominal transducer handling
  • Pelvic orientation and anatomical landmarks
Module 3: First-Trimester Obstetric Ultrasound
  • Early pregnancy identification
  • Gestational sac and fetal pole visualization
  • Systematic first-trimester scanning workflow
Module 4: Transvaginal Ultrasound Simulation
  • Intracavitary probe handling techniques
  • Orientation and depth control
  • Detailed pelvic anatomy identification
Module 5: Image Optimization & Scan Quality Control
  • B-mode image optimization
  • Depth, zoom, brightness, and contrast adjustments
  • Image clarity and artifact awareness
Module 6: Integrated Scanning & Clinical Readiness
  • Real-time anatomy visualization with probe tracking
  • Complete simulated OBGYN ultrasound examinations
  • Scan consistency and workflow refinement
